Hello, Im trying to simulate with Abaqus CEL the impact of the polymer melt on an insert (a wire) in an injection molding cavity. A major problem is to model the polymer melt material behaviour like temperature und and shear rate dependent viscosity (Cross-Arrhenius in a VUVISCOSITY Sub) and the pvT-behaviour (2domain Tait in a VUEOS Sub). Especially the pvt behaviour is difficult. Abaqus expects a formula for the pressure, so I converted the tait equation for pressure ignoring v_1 and wrote it into the VUEOS subroutine that I have attached. Currently abaqus calculates a negative pressure at the first elements to be filled and quits the simulation with an error due to excessive distortion of elements. It seems like abaqus assigns a temperature to elements that are being filled which is lower than the actual melt temperature leading to a negative pressure. This could be because the nodes that are not filled yet are not assigned a temperature, so they appear with zero Kelvin. I want Abaqus to ignore this temperature as the elements belonging to these nodes are not filled. I added the current input, odb and the tait subroutine file.
